A 2-in-1 laptop is a hybrid device that combines the features of a laptop and a tablet. It has a touchscreen and can be folded or detached to switch between typing and touch-based modes. Unlike traditional laptops, 2-in-1s offer flexibility, ideal for drawing, streaming, or note-taking. You get the power of a laptop and the convenience of a tablet in one device, making it useful for students, designers, or multitaskers on the go.

Yes, 2-in-1 laptops are great for students and professionals. They’re lightweight, portable, and offer touch and pen input, which is perfect for taking notes, sketching, or giving presentations. The keyboard lets you do typical work tasks, while tablet mode is ideal for reading or entertainment. They're especially useful in hybrid learning or remote work setups, where switching between formats improves productivity and comfort. Many models also come with stylus support for added creativity and control.

Some high-performance 2-in-1 laptops can handle light gaming and basic video editing, especially those with powerful processors, ample RAM, and integrated or entry-level dedicated GPUs. However, they’re not designed to replace gaming rigs or high-end editing stations. For casual gaming, multitasking, or occasional content creation, they work well. If you need advanced graphic performance, go for models with stronger specs like Intel Core i7/i9 or AMD Ryzen 7 and a dedicated GPU.
